UNC Blanks SMU to Reach NCAA Men’s Soccer Elite Eight
Posted Nov 25, 2017
For the eighth time in 10 years, the UNC men’s soccer team will be heading to the Elite Eight in the NCAA Tournament. The Tar Heels used a pair of second-half goals to defeat SMU 2-0 in Saturday’s Third Round match at WakeMed Soccer Park (Highlights). The Tar Heels advance to the NCAA Quarterfinals, where it will play the winner of Fordham and No. 6 Duke.
